Swede Turns a Lamborghini Gallardo into…a Ski Transporter

|

We'd hardly call the Lamborghini Gallardo –or any exotic supercar for that matter- the most appropriate type of vehicle for skiers travelling from one ski resort to the other, but professional freeskier and alpine ski racer Jon Olson strongly disagrees.

The 29 year-old Swede has made a habit of using Lamborghinis as his personal vehicles for driving to various ski events across Europe.

He first did it with a Murcielago LP670 Superveloce that he equipped with a ski-box, but once he laid eyes on the new Aventador, he sold the limited edition and ordered the new Lambo. The problem was that the Aventador has a long waiting list so he decided to buy a…Gallardo LP560 as his temporary daily drive.

Not the one to wait, Olson ordered a custom made ski box that is approved for use at speeds of up to 255km/h (159mph). He then sent the car to Lambo specialist DMC that made some styling changes and to Autostripe that covered the Gallardo in a cammo wrap.
